Narvar

Narvar

Narvar is an intelligent post-purchase platform that builds loyalty through personalized experiences and smart actions, empowering brands to create lifelong customer relationships.

Media
251-1K
Founded 2012
$64M raised

Description

  • Implement new product features and support or extend existing ones.
  • Build frontend platform components used across internal products, external products, and ecommerce storefronts such as Shopify and Salesforce.
  • Contribute to overall architecture and maintain code quality standards in partnership with senior engineers.
  • Work with product and design teams to translate wireframes and mockups into functional UI components.
  • Develop and maintain backend services using Golang and Node.js.
  • Deploy code and infrastructure components in a cloud and CI/CD environment.
  • Work with databases such as Postgres, Spanner, and BigQuery.
  • Design and implement RESTful or GraphQL APIs.
  • Contribute to consumer-facing applications that consume APIs from a microservice backend system.
  • Mentor other engineers and participate in code reviews.

Requirements

  • BS/MS in computer science, information systems, or an equivalent field.
  • 10+ years of experience building reliable, scalable, high-quality systems.
  • Experience building consumer-facing applications with a frontend framework such as React, Svelte, Angular, Vue, or Ember, with React preferred.
  • Experience building software with Node.js or Golang.
  • Experience developing consumer-facing applications that consume APIs from a microservice backend system.
  • Experience with cloud platforms such as AWS, Azure, or GCP is a plus.
  • Knowledge of the full development lifecycle and computer science fundamentals.
  • Strong focus on code quality and code reviews.
  • Experience mentoring other engineers.
  • Previous startup experience strongly preferred, with a growth and product engineering mindset.

Benefits

  • Base salary range of $180,000 to $230,000 CAD.
  • Annual bonus eligibility.
  • Equity package.
  • Additional benefits included in the offer.
  • Remote work designation (#LI-Remote).

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Staff Product Engineer

LawnStarter 11-50 Professional Services

LawnStarter is hiring a Product Engineer to lead initiative-based product work on its shared marketplace platform, partnering with product and design while using AI agents to ship customer- and pro-facing improvements that move business metrics.

Apache Airflow AWS Confluence Datadog dbt GitHub Actions JIRA Laravel PHP React React Native Segment TypeScript
54 minutes ago

Senior Software Engineer II AI-Native, Circle Expansion

Life360 251-1K Family Services

Life360 is hiring an AI-Native Engineer to help the Circle Expansion team build and ship consumer products that keep families, aging parents, and connected communities safe and coordinated.

Android AWS iOS Java Kubernetes LLM Mobile Development
57 minutes ago

Fullstack PHP developer (Magento 2 + WordPress) - Remote. Latin America

Bluelight Consulting 11-50 Internet Software & Services

Bluelight is hiring a remote Full Stack Developer to own and support clients’ Magento 2 and WordPress ecosystems, ensuring stability, integrations, and smooth technical transitions across e-commerce and content platforms.

Apache CRM CSS Elasticsearch ERP Git GraphQL HTML JavaScript Less Linux MySQL Nginx Redis REST API Sass WordPress
1 hour, 8 minutes ago

[Job-29470] Master AI Developer, Brazil

CI&T 5K-10K Internet Software & Services

CI&T is hiring a Master AI Developer in Brazil to lead the end-to-end creation of AI-driven software features, from requirements and architecture through deployment and monitoring in a remote, international setting.

Agile Azure Docker Java Jenkins Kafka Kubernetes LLM Microservices Node.js PostgreSQL Python React Spring Boot
1 hour, 58 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ers